Care Home Administrator £13.91 per hour

Hours: 38.5 hours per week working a 3 on 3 off rolling 6 week rota 8am - 8pm

Choose to live life in Colour by working at Borough Care where we believe that everyone should be encouraged and supported to live their best possible life.

By working with us you will receive some excellent rewards & benefits including:

  • 28 days holiday, with an additional day holiday for your birthday (after 1 years service)
  • Free meals
  • Access to My Hub, with a range of discounts for high street shops, supermarkets and restaurants
  • Free uniforms
  • Paid DBS check
  • Refer a Friend Scheme you'll get £375 once the person joins the Borough Care family
  • Employee Assistance Programme that supports on all aspects of your lifestyle including free counselling and financial advice
  • Long term sick payments
  • Life Assurance cover
  • Pension plan
  • Fully-funded training for nationally recognised qualifications
  • Career progression opportunities

About the role

As an Administrator based in one of our care homes, you will provide general administrative support including maintaining records and files, updating databases and processing orders. You will also answer telephone queries and provide reception cover.
